About Our Founder

In late 2021, Lynn R. Wells and Linda A. Kapp, CPA, assumed full ownership of Wells & Kapp, CPAs, LLC after Paul Wells passed away in September. Lynn worked alongside Paul since he first founded his accounting firm.  Linda worked with the firm from 1991 through 1995 and then returned August 2016.  Linda joined Paul as partner in January 2020 when the firm name was changed to its current name.

A life-long Paris resident, Paul graduated from Baylor University with a BBA in Accounting in 1972. Clients will remember his love for all things Baylor, especially Baylor sports.  After graduation, Paul worked for the Carnation Company in San Antonio for five years then worked at a bookkeeping service in Paris for two years before founding his own CPA practice.  His firm was originally established as Paul T. Wells, CPA in November 1979. Though he had a few partners at different times and a few firm name changes, Paul remained firmly at the helm for more than 40 years.

Offices were originally located at 41 1st NW with Paul’s brother Tommy Wells’ law office.  He later moved the business to 10 SE 8th Street, and in 1983 when he outgrew that space, the firm moved to the current location at 1323 Lamar Avenue, the former home place of Paul’s paternal grandparents.
